Malachy Tallack is an award-winning author and singer-songwriter from Shetland. He has written both fiction and non-fiction, and has spoken at events across Scotland and the UK, as well as overseas. He has taught creative writing in short workshops and in residential courses.

His first book, Sixty Degrees North, was a work of travel and memoir, and was broadcast on BBC Radio 4 as a Book of the Week. His second, The Un-Discovered Islands, was named Illustrated Book of the Year at the Edward Stanford Travel Writing Awards in 2017. His most recent book, The Valley at the Centre of the World, was a novel, published by Canongate in 2018. (Photo credit: Paul Bloomer)
